C语言手撕实战代码_二叉树_构造二叉树_层序遍历二叉树_二叉树深度的超详细代码实现
二叉树习题 1.通过前序序列和中序序列构造二叉树 2.通过层次遍历序列和中序序列创建一棵二叉树 3.求一棵二叉树的结点个数 4.求一棵二叉树的叶子节点数 5.求一棵二叉树中度为1的节点个数 6.求二叉树的高度 7.求一棵二叉树中值为x的节点作为根节点的子树深度 ...
从C语言到C++_33(C++11_上)initializer_list+右值引用+完美转发+移动构造/赋值(下)
从C语言到C++_33(C++11_上)initializer_list+右值引用+完美转发+移动构造/赋值(中):https://developer.aliyun.com/article/1522391 4. 完美转发 4.1 万能引用(引用折叠) 写多个重载函数,根据实参类型调用不同函数。 形参类型分别是左值引用,const左值引用,右值引用,c...
从C语言到C++_33(C++11_上)initializer_list+右值引用+完美转发+移动构造/赋值(上)
$stringUtil.substring( $!{XssContent1.description},200)...
从C语言到C++_33(C++11_上)initializer_list+右值引用+完美转发+移动构造/赋值(中)
从C语言到C++_33(C++11_上)initializer_list+右值引用+完美转发+移动构造/赋值(上):https://developer.aliyun.com/article/1522384 3.3 左值引用与右值引用比较 思考:左值引用可以引用右值吗? 要知道,右值引用是C++11才出来的,...
C语言——构造数据类型
构造数据类型 构造数据类型是由基本数据类型组合而成的复杂数据类型,用于表示更复杂的数据结构。C 语言中的构造数据类型包括数组、结构体和共用体。 1. 数组:数组是一组相同类型的变量的集合,它们在内存中按顺序存储在一起,并通过索引访问。 ...
Linux系统下C语言的构造数据类型
Linux系统下C语言的构造数据类型 在C语言中,构造数据类型允许我们将不同的数据类型组合在一起,以创建更复杂的数据结构。这种能力使得我们能够更好地组织和管理数据。下面是几个在Linux系统下使用C语言实现构造数据类型的代码示例: 1. 结构体(Structures) 结构体允许我们将不同类型的数据组合成一个新的数据类型。例如,我们可以定义一个表示学生的结构体,其中包含姓...
C语言之 数据结构入门——顺序表的构造
一、顺序表是什么?-谈论顺序表前,谈谈线性表(linear list)是n个具有相同特性的数据元素的有限序列。 线性表是一种在实际中广泛使用的数据结构,常见的线性表:顺序表、链表、栈、队列、字符串…顺序表是数据结构的线性表的其中一小类,线性表是指n个具有相同性质的数据元素的有限序列顺序表...
【C语言】构造数据类型(自定义数据类型)相关知识点
构造数据类型构造数据类型:自己建立的数据类型(自定义数据类型)。C语言中的构造数据类型有:数组类型、结构体类型、共用体类型和枚举类型。一、结构体1、定义和使用结构体变量1)什么是结构体?C语言允许用户根据需要自己建立的由不同类型数据组成的组合型的数据类型,我们把它称之为结构体(stru...
「自定义类型」C语言中的构造数据类型如结构,联合,枚举
目录🐰结构🌸数据类型的定义🌸关键字struct 与 class 的困惑🌸使用struct🐰位域(位段)🐰成员对齐 🌸结构内存大小的计算🐰联合(Union)🌸联合内存大小的计算🐰枚举&...
gcc对C语言的扩展:构造函数调用(Constructing Function Calls)
$stringUtil.substring( $!{XssContent1.description},200)...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
+关注